-
Brook Taverner Alba Long Sleeve Slim Fit Poplin Shirt - White
Regular price £38.95 GBPRegular priceUnit price per -
Brook Taverner Andora Long Sleeve Herringbone Shirt - White Herringbone
Regular price £63.95 GBPRegular priceUnit price per -
Brook Taverner Rosello Short Sleeve Poplin Shirt - Blue
Regular price £38.25 GBPRegular priceUnit price per -
Brook Taverner Rosello Short Sleeve Poplin Shirt - White
Regular price £38.25 GBPRegular priceUnit price per -
Brook Taverner Rapino Long Sleeve Poplin Shirt - Blue
Regular price £39.00 GBPRegular priceUnit price per -
Brook Taverner Rapino Long Sleeve Poplin Shirt - White
Regular price £39.00 GBPRegular priceUnit price per -
Brook Taverner Pisa Long Sleeve Slim Fit Shirt - Sky Blue
Regular price £55.25 GBPRegular priceUnit price per -
Brook Taverner Pisa Long Sleeve Slim Fit Shirt - White
Regular price £55.25 GBPRegular priceUnit price per -
Brook Taverner Memphis Waistcoat - Grey Brown Check
Regular price From £85.40 GBPRegular priceUnit price per -
Brook Taverner Memphis Waistcoat - Charcoal Herringbone
Regular price From £85.40 GBPRegular priceUnit price per -
Brook Taverner Memphis Waistcoat - Navy Check
Regular price From £85.40 GBPRegular priceUnit price per -
Brook Taverner Memphis Waistcoat - Navy Herringbone
Regular price From £85.40 GBPRegular priceUnit price per -
Brook Taverner One Mercury Waistcoat - Navy
Regular price £62.35 GBPRegular priceUnit price per -
Brook Taverner One Mercury Waistcoat - Black
Regular price £62.35 GBPRegular priceUnit price per -
Brook Taverner Sophisticated Cassino Jacket - Charcoal
Regular price £141.65 GBPRegular priceUnit price per -
Brook Taverner Sophisticated Cassino Jacket - Navy
Regular price £141.65 GBPRegular priceUnit price per